Spicerhaart, the UK's largest independent estate agency group headquartered in Colchester, Essex, has initiated a new project focused on charity clothes recycling. This project allows staff to contribute pre-loved clothes, which can then be claimed by colleagues in exchange for a donation to Magic Moments, the company's in-house charity. Magic Moments supports children and their families during challenging times with an unforgettable trip to Disneyland Paris. Any remaining unclaimed items will be donated to the local homeless charity, Beacon House.

Pippa Major, a Magic Moments Board Member and Operations Manager & Business Analyst to the Group Managing Director at Spicerhaart, highlighted the significance of the initiative. She said "Our Spicerhaart family have been donating preloved clothes, so that others can enjoy them, which is incredibly important for the sustainability of our planet. We are helping the environment by reducing our carbon emissions, reducing unnecessary use of water and energy whilst both minimising our contributions to landfill and incinerators. It’s our way of educating and ensuring that our family are conscious consumers, while supporting our own charity at the same time. We’re also encouraging them to bring in other items, such as books, which people can enjoy in their breaks, and household groceries which may otherwise go to waste.”

Spicerhaart is actively exploring ways to extend similar initiatives to accommodate staff working remotely or across branches nationwide. Antony Lark, Spicerhaart Group Managing Director, expressed his enthusiasm for the initiative, stating "As a company we take our responsibilities to protect our environment seriously and I am delighted to see initiatives like this really come to life. What’s particularly pleasing is how these ideas have been generated by individuals. Pippa, as an example, has shown great passion for this and it is going to be a huge success in so many ways.”
